Do digital copies of games expire?

Do digital copies of games expire?

Download codes purchased from retailers do not expire. However, download codes given out for a specific promotion, such as Pokémon distributions, will usually have an expiration date. This will be noted in the information about the promotion or the materials the download code was provided with.

Do you actually own digital games?

Do you actually own digital games?

If you further research the topic, you'll find out that you actually do not own the games, and never had. What you do “own” is the digital license to use them, with many different systems working against having access to the files that you've paid for!

Do you have to buy a digital game again if you delete it?

Do you have to buy a digital game again if you delete it?

Uninstalling a game from any platform does not remove the license you purchased for that game, it simply removes the files from your local computer storage.

Who owns digital games?

Who owns digital games?

Games purchased digitally are legally licenses and not sold, meaning consumers do not have legal ownership and cannot resell their games. Compared to physically distributed games, digital games cannot be destroyed because they can be redownloaded from the distribution system.

What happens when you buy a digital game?

What happens when you buy a digital game?

When you purchase a digital game, you will receive an email for a code you can redeem within your gaming console. You may need to create an account and sign in to the system's network to access the download. A broadband Internet connection is recommended.

Why are digital games still expensive?

Why are digital games still expensive?

The most obvious one is that digital games need infrastructure to maintain them. The game has to be stored in a data center and served to users all over the world using top-tier bandwidth. When you buy a physical game disc, it doesn't cost the platform provider anything for it to sit on your shelf.

Can I get a digital copy of a game I already own switch?

With the Nintendo Switch you can purchase and download a digital copy of a physical game you own. The physical game does not give you rights to a free digital copy, and never will with Nintendo. For most Switch games a digital copy will be able to use the game save data created by your physical copy.


Can you redownload purchased games on switch?

Can you redownload purchased games on switch?

Open the Nintendo eShop with the Nintendo Account that purchased the game. Select the icon in the upper-right corner to access your Account Information. Highlight Redownload on the left side of the screen. A list of titles you've purchased will appear.

Are digital copies legal?

Yes, under certain conditions as provided by section 117 of the Copyright Act. Although the precise term used under section 117 is “archival” copy, not “backup” copy, these terms today are used interchangeably.


Can you get sued for making a similar game?

Can you get sued for making a similar game?

Once a game has been made public, nothing in the copyright law prevents others from developing another game based on similar principles. Copyright protects only the particular manner of an author's expression in literary, artistic, or musical form.
